## Key Ceremony Checklist — Item 7

- Before signing, double-check undo/redo in Sketchfen behaves after the history-store migration. Draw a few shapes, undo five times, redo five times, and make sure nothing vanishes or duplicates — support has seen ghost arrows before. If it looks wrong, halt the ceremony and ping the Sketchfen crew. To open the ceremony vault and fetch the signing material, you'll need the recovery passphrase, and for this ceremony it is recorded on the following line.

recovery phrase for fawif-tajeg: norael-aldmir-casir-brivan-ulaion

## Formula Sandboxing

Velloquent lets customers embed spreadsheet-style formulas in report templates. All user-supplied formulas execute inside the Quillbox sandbox: no filesystem, no network, a 50ms CPU budget, and a capped AST depth. Never add a builtin function without a sandbox review — past incidents came from "harmless" string helpers. Escape hatches are deliberately absent; don't add one. The sandbox policy file lives in the `quillbox-policy` repo. For sandbox reviews or policy changes, email the runtime safety group.

alerts address for bafog-tawep: ulavan_sorwyn_fraax@kelviworks.local

# Flagline Rollout Framework — Contacts

Flagline controls staged feature-flag rollouts for all Quellith services. If a rollout stalls or flags desync, check the Flagline dashboard first, then restart the sync worker. Do not force-publish flags without approval. Rollback is safe and idempotent. Ownership: the Delivery Platform squad (Tova Meric, lead). For urgent rollout issues outside business hours, reach the Flagline escalation inbox directly.

escalation mailbox, bafog-fafog: ulador@paliqlabs.internal